Possible Causes of Fire and Smoke Damage

Fire incidents can be caused by multiple factors, including electrical faults, unattended cooking, heating equipment, or candles. Sometimes, electrical issues like faulty wiring or overloaded outlets ignite fires that quickly spread through a property, producing smoke damage across walls, ceilings, and furnishings.

In addition, careless disposal of smoking materials, cooking accidents, or malfunctioning appliances can also result in smoke damage inside your property. Even small fires that are extinguished early can leave behind a strong odor and soot residue that requires professional cleaning to fully eliminate.

How Our Experts Can Fix That

Our team begins with a thorough assessment of your property to identify the extent of fire and smoke damage. We utilize advanced smoke detection and analysis tools to pinpoint lingering odors and residue that may not be immediately visible. This initial evaluation ensures our approach is tailored specifically to your situation.

Next, we proceed with the cleaning and deodorization process. We use specialized cleaning agents and techniques designed to break down soot and smoke particles deeply embedded in surfaces, fabrics, and air ducts. Our professionals also employ ozone treatments and thermal fogging methods, which neutralize odors at the molecular level, providing long-lasting results.

Finally, we focus on restoring your property’s air quality. Proper ventilation, HEPA filtration, and air scrubbers are employed to remove airborne particles and residual odors. Frequently Asked Questions

How long does smoke odor removal typically take?

The duration depends on the extent of the damage. Minor odor issues can often be resolved within a few hours, while more severe cases may require a full day or more. Our team provides an accurate timeline after a thorough inspection.

Will I need to leave my property during the odor removal process?

In most cases, you won’t have to leave. We perform our procedures efficiently and can work around your schedule. For certain treatments like ozone, temporary evacuation might be recommended for safety reasons, but we inform you beforehand.

Are your odor removal methods safe for pets and children?

Absolutely. We use environmentally friendly and non-toxic products that are safe for your family, pets, and the environment. Ensuring safety is a top priority during all restoration procedures.

What should I do immediately after a fire to minimize odor damage?

Can odors return after treatment?

Our advanced treatments are designed to provide long-lasting results. However, in cases of ongoing sources of smoke or poor ventilation, odors can reappear. Proper post-treatment ventilation and maintenance help ensure lasting freshness.
